英文摘要
The number of people living in cities in Africa is growing faster than in any other part of the world. Poverty, lack of alternatives and limited regulations have also increased the use of polluting cars and fuels by families and small industries. This has resulted in high levels of air pollution which puts the residents at risk of different diseases. However, the governments do not have complete information on where in cities air pollution is high; nor do they know how different sources are distributed around the city. The equipment used for measuring air pollution in wealthy countries is too large and expensive to be used in African cities. Our network of African and UK universities, together with partners in government, community and industry, plans to fully map what information is needed to help control air pollution and use new forms of technologies, like data from satellites and artificial intelligence, to create new ways of measuring and monitoring air pollution in African cities.
